Output d2621ce7e0b5f75375ec6ab5b5140b4b68a7b57a160cbcd2b3a63aa2f58101f1:2

value
2633044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d47a274788cbf9e9f7bd1defa5322927094598e6 OP_EQUAL
address
3M4VWafgFgp4JbHvb8oxQizqgJeJvhnwoc
transaction
d2621ce7e0b5f75375ec6ab5b5140b4b68a7b57a160cbcd2b3a63aa2f58101f1
spent
true